V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  jhdxr  ›  全部回复第 93 页 / 共 103 页
回复总数  2042
1 ... 89  90  91  92  93  94  95  96  97  98 ... 103  
2016-05-16 11:50:56 +08:00
回复了 vus520 创建的主题 问与答 PHP 项目重构计划,推荐 GO 还是 Node js?
1. 不管用什么语言,你业务到了一定规模以后堆机器是必然的。架构上你要解决的是能够优雅地堆机器,而不是到了要堆机器的时候就换个语言。。。
2. CPU 密集的确不是 PHP 的强项,但是是 C 的强项啊。。。最直接的想法不是 C 写个模块封装下 PHP 去调么
3. 『目前团队只有 PHP 基础,核心业务的重构准备用其它语言实现』

看了你的前一个帖子,我不觉得换一个语言就能解决压缩效率的问题。。。当然如果你只是想玩玩学习下别的语言就随意了。。。只不过拿核心业务这么玩_(:з」∠)_
不能连续三个的话。。。连着两个还是可以的吧
路过支持
一个有意思的数据, 9 小时前 append 的是『 172 人接受邀请, 152 人等待接受邀请』,在 GitHub 上可见的用户却只有 43 人。。。
jhdxr
2016-05-12 02:05:02 +08:00
回复了 pine 创建的主题 MySQL php mysql mysqli 的三个问题
RTFM , http://php.net/manual/zh/mysqli.overview.php 解决了你的大部分疑问。最后一条, mysqli 为什么不能跨库?你遇到什么错误了?

此外,@pubby 为什么不手写 SQL ? ORM 不是适用于所有场景的(除非你写的都是简单的 CRUD )
2016-05-11 15:46:51 +08:00
回复了 egonetworks 创建的主题 推广 我们的活动没那么复杂,留言抽奖送 T 恤
我是来拉低中奖率的
2016-05-09 13:08:19 +08:00
回复了 lyp111332 创建的主题 PHP php 接收客户端传来的值,如何防止被转化为科学计数法
@GTim 不需要, PHP 的 json_decode 支持大数直接转为 string 的,有 option 的
2016-05-09 13:07:33 +08:00
回复了 lyp111332 创建的主题 PHP php 接收客户端传来的值,如何防止被转化为科学计数法
@lyp111332 1. 提问的时候你没说清楚客户端传的是 json ,你自己做了一步 decode (这很重要); 2. RTFM
http://php.net/manual/en/function.json-decode.php
2016-05-07 22:57:24 +08:00
回复了 YUX 创建的主题 分享发现 我觉得 IDN 域名可以考虑入手了 Chromium 已经能显示出来
firefox 似乎很早就可以了。 至于钓鱼。。其实我觉得这会让更多的从业人士上当。。。圈外的人懂得去识别域名( taobao.comtaobao.com.example.org )的有多少
2016-05-04 14:55:42 +08:00
回复了 qurioust 创建的主题 程序员 基于 session 和基于 token 的用户认证方式到底该如何选择?
@jimrok 可是 session 不一定非得基于 cookie 的(当然时至今日大家大多使用 cookie ),例如各种 WAP 版一般直接使用 query string 来储存 session id
2016-04-26 21:19:36 +08:00
回复了 xiaoshangmin 创建的主题 PHP 求教几个 php 问题
@fising 不是优先级的问题,你 LS @UnisandK 给出了正解。至于敲两个就不报错是因为 `'a'..0` 被解释成了 `'a'` `.` `.0`,也就是字符串 'a' 和数字 0 进行拼接

btw ,介绍个函数: http://php.net/manual/zh/function.token-get-all.php
以 LZ 所说的为例
```
$arr = token_get_all("<?php var_dump('a'.0);");
var_dump(array_map(function($a){
if(is_array($a)) {
$a[4] = token_name($a[0]);
}
return $a;
}, $arr));
```
结果为
array(7) {
[0]=>
array(4) {
[0]=>
int(379)
[1]=>
string(6) "<?php "
[2]=>
int(1)
[4]=>
string(10) "T_OPEN_TAG"
}
[1]=>
array(4) {
[0]=>
int(319)
[1]=>
string(8) "var_dump"
[2]=>
int(1)
[4]=>
string(8) "T_STRING"
}
[2]=>
string(1) "("
[3]=>
array(4) {
[0]=>
int(323)
[1]=>
string(3) "'a'"
[2]=>
int(1)
[4]=>
string(26) "T_CONSTANT_ENCAPSED_STRING"
}
[4]=>
array(4) {
[0]=>
int(318)
[1]=>
string(2) ".0"
[2]=>
int(1)
[4]=>
string(9) "T_DNUMBER"
}
[5]=>
string(1) ")"
[6]=>
string(1) ";"
}

可以很直接的看出 .0 被识别为一个数字了
2016-04-26 20:47:25 +08:00
回复了 xiaoshangmin 创建的主题 PHP 求教几个 php 问题
我补充下 @UnisandK 的回答,为什么不是 'a' - 'z',是因为 `for(AA;BB;CC)` 是相当于
```
AA;
while(BB){
//stmt
CC
}
```

那么当累加到 'z' 后,再累加一次就成了 'aa' (参照文档说明),而根据字符串比较规则, 'aa' < 'z'。只有一直累加到 'za' 才是大于 'z' 的。

如果想要 a 到 z 直接 range('a', 'z')吧
@ChoateYao 你这一黑黑两个了。。。
那人的项目(包括建在它自己名下的,和它所主导的组下的)全是改个名字去除 license 的。。。
那个 leaps 也就是 yii 改个名字去掉版权_(:з」∠)_

估计这人也就是想“装饰”下自己的 github ,同时混个“曾给知名项目 yii 贡献过源码”呵呵呵呵呵



GitHub 的 takedown 好像是针对 repo 的(如果有错请指正),所以 LZ 还是提个 pr revert 了吧,至于要不要再新提交给 pr 去重新提交就随意了。。。

btw ,你现在的这个 issue 真的是不知所云_(:з」∠)_ 完全没有提及你的诉求是什么
2016-04-19 20:18:58 +08:00
回复了 cstj0505 创建的主题 业界八卦 国内那些翻译 IT 书的都是语文不及格吗
@cstj0505 既然是译文版,那自然肯定是要翻译的,最多也就翻译后标注原文是啥而已。至于术语的翻译一直是一个难题,我个人的做法是参考行业内已有的一些相关概念的翻译,如果都没有的话,那就只能按自己的理解意译了。。。

上面有个回复说的很好,翻译考的是中文水平而不是英文水平。

利益相关: PHP 手册中文版志愿者
1 ... 89  90  91  92  93  94  95  96  97  98 ... 103  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   4594 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 44ms · UTC 03:52 · PVG 11:52 · LAX 19:52 · JFK 22:52
Developed with CodeLauncher
♥ Do have faith in what you're doing.